Output ef3e37524c6767561720daf98aa2efbf22de174dd32d86143ef5a40e4d8b7a31:0

value
48192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c87004dc85a7e4a1c9a1e21c9c240b58e1dbbf OP_EQUAL
address
34meLXAmdE25LTVtcgv71VAyGC3eMJuGqo
transaction
ef3e37524c6767561720daf98aa2efbf22de174dd32d86143ef5a40e4d8b7a31
spent
true